If you imagine the clear outer glass-like enamel of your tooth being a window through which we see the underlying tooth itself called the dentin. The dentin provides the natural ivory/white colour of your tooth. Cosmetic teeth whitening cleans this stained enamel window so that the natural ivory/white colour of the dentin is revealed.

It is best to wait 2 weeks after having your teeth professionally cleaned before having your teeth whitened as this can dramatically increase your risk of tooth sensitivity.
The Teeth Whitening treatment provides dramatic results for anyone who wants to whiten their teeth. This includes people with teeth that have been stained by smoking or by substances such as coffee or tea. It also whitens teeth antibiotically stained by tetracycline, speckled by fluoride, or hereditary discolouration. Pregnant or Breast Feeding or under 16yrs: All Teeth Whitening is ‘Contraindicated’ for Women Pregnant & Breast feeding and children under 16-yo. That means, although these reasons have not been scientifically proven, these factors are considered to serve as a reason to withhold a certain treatment during this time. Therefore, until scientific research studies these factors and says yes or no, certain products are ‘Contraindicated’ as an unproven safety risk.
Because all teeth whiten differently it is not possible to guarantee how white an individual’s teeth might become. Nevertheless, for most, after undergoing whitening with our In-Clinic Teeth Whitening System, teeth shades whiten between 2 to 14 shades depending upon how stained your teeth are. Of course, if your teeth start at say a 5, the very maximum you can whiten is 5 shades. Although individual results vary, the end result will be a whiter, shiny smile. Some clients with badly stained teeth or Tetracycline (antibiotic) staining may require several procedures.

This varies from person to person and depends on diet and lifestyle; for a few fortunate individuals with atypical diets the effects can last up to 1-2 years. However, for most, their teeth whitening lasts 3 – 9 months. Periodic touch-up treatments are recommended 3-monthly for clients who frequently consume coffee or other staining foods and drinks or for those that use tobacco products.
